Shree Maheshwar Hydel Power to start generation in 2-3 months

Press Trust of India Rome

M W Corp Group-promoted Shree Maheshwar Hydel Power Corporation (SMHPCL), the first private sector power initiative in Madhya Pradesh, is likely to start electricity generation within the next 2-3 months, a top official said today.

"The 400-Mw project on the River Narmada is ready and is likely to start in 2-3 months after getting clearance from the concerned ministry," M W Corp Vice-Chairman Warij Kasliwal told reporters here.

Initially, three turbine sets comprising 10 turbine units of 40 Mw each will become operational, he said, adding that this is the first big private venture in the hydel power sector in Madhya Pradesh and will cost about Rs 2,600 crore.

 

Under the agreement signed between SMHPDL and the Madhya Pradesh State Electricity Board, the state will get 100 per cent of the electricity generated from this project.

Kasliwal, who is in Italy as part of FICCI's CEOs delegation, led by Commerce and Industry Minister Anand Sharma, has talked to a few Italian solar energy companies for a technology partnership on its new solar project in Rajasthan.

He said, "We have got two solar projects of 1 Mw and 10 Mw each in Rajasthan. We have signed the power purchase agreement (PPA) and announcement needs to be done."

"We require an investment of Rs 400 crore for solar project in Rajasthan. We are still looking at having a tie-up for funds and technology tie-up," he said, adding that the project will commence in a year's time.
